On 15 February, we mark 141 years of The Methodist Church in Singapore.
Over the last 141 years, MCS has sought to live out what John Wesley called “social holiness”, a faith that is never private, but expressed in love, service and responsibility towards our neighbours.
From pioneering schools that nurture generations, to community outreach and social services that care for the vulnerable, this “faith working by love” has shaped who we are.
In the latest edition of Methodist Message, Dr Roland Chia reflects on Wesley’s vision of social holiness and how MCS has practised it since our founding.
As we celebrate 141 years, may we continue to embody a faith that serves.

Lent is here, a 40 day journey of preparation, repentance and renewal.
As we remember Jesus’ time in the wilderness and His road to the cross, we are invited to examine our own hearts, to lay aside what weighs us down, to resist what pulls us away from God, and to fix our eyes on Christ so that we may walk in newness of life.
Lent is not just about giving something up. It is about being formed, shaped more deeply into the likeness of Jesus.
What might God be shaping in you this season?

We live in an age of rapid technological change—where AI is reshaping how we work, communicate, and even how we worship. This March, as we navigate this "digital Babylon", Bishop Philip Lim reminds us, "The danger lies not in using AI, but in confusing efficiency with wisdom, automation with discernment, and innovation with spiritual depth. AI can never be a substitute for prayer—it cannot replace communication and connection with the body of Christ."
As we engage our digital world thoughtfully, may we hold fast to what no machine can replicate. Faith is not about rejecting the tools of our time, but about using them wisely and redemptively—always anchored in the truth that "the fear of the Lord is the beginning of wisdom" (Proverbs 9:10)
